David Obura is a Founding Director at CORDIO East Africa, based in Mombasa, working on coral reefs, coastal sustainability and climate change.
David Obura is a Founding Director at CORDIO East Africa, based in Mombasa, working on coral reefs, coastal sustainability and climate change.